Flemer" <jf...@ac...>, jim...@us... Dear Mr. Flemer, As you redesign phpESP, I would like to remind you te be careful not to use terms confusingly similar with our trademark for EZSURVEY. Since US trademark law includes phonetic similarities, we consider use of the name "Easy Survey" for competing products to be an infringement of our rights. Your GUI redesign preview, while attractive, is not consistent with what we agreed in 2002. While I regret giving you as much latitude as I did, I am still willing to accept "phpESP - php Easy Survey Package", but not "Easy Survey Package" or "php Easy Survey Package" on its own. I suggest you read =A732-35 (15 U.S.C. =A71114) (http://www.uspto.gov/web/offices/tac/tmlaw2.html ) if you are doubt as to your responsibilities. Since phpESP has been reviewed in EWeek, I consider it a direct competitor to EZSurvey. I suggest you consider finding a new name altogether so as to avoid confusion with EZSurvey.
